a) In Normal Envelope mode, the envelope follower output level is relative to the audio input level. In Inverted Envelope mode, the envelope follower output level is maximized when no audio exists, and the output level declines as the audio input level rises. In Normal Gate mode, the envelope follower output level becomes zero when the audio input level does not reach the open threshold. The envelope follower level is maximized when the audio input level exceeds the gate close threshold. In Inverted Gate mode, the envelope follower output level is maximized when the audio input level does not reach the open threshold. The envelope follower level is zero when the audio input level exceeds the gate close threshold.

Preset Bank 1 contains presets for TC Reverb. These presets are divided into the following categories. Ambience Creates natural acoustic environment, not a clearlyframed reverb. Box Contains many reverberations. Chamber Simulates a room acoustic. FX Creates unnatural, special effect sound. Tunnel Simulates a thin, long space.
